bthost: fragment when sending ISO packets
Support fragmentation to controller MTU when sending ISO packets.
By default, fragment when exceeding btdev iso_mtu.

iso-tester: add tests for hardware RX timestamps
Add tests for HW RX timestamping. Also add test that sends large
packets to test ISO fragmentation.
Add tests:
ISO Receive - HW Timestamping
ISO Receive Fragmented - Success
ISO Receive Fragmented - HW Timestamping
